Transaction 12baaeca60fa56f1d771868252623be080a3154075a2b2b7462599f185980c7e

1 Input
2 Outputs
  • 12baaeca60fa56f1d771868252623be080a3154075a2b2b7462599f185980c7e:0
  • value  121632
    address  3226TsaXQE7j8WkupLyq4n3Nd1EAq24v1R
  • 12baaeca60fa56f1d771868252623be080a3154075a2b2b7462599f185980c7e:1
  • value  139548
    address  bc1qppkxt2pday9qtetpd97m6vrepvgj05c2f28gs7